RESUMO

BACKGROUND: Chronic limb-threatening ischaemia is the severest manifestation of peripheral arterial disease and presents with ischaemic pain at rest or tissue loss (ulceration, gangrene, or both), or both. We compared the effectiveness of a vein bypass first with a best endovascular treatment first revascularisation strategy in terms of preventing major amputation and death in patients with chronic limb threatening ischaemia who required an infra-popliteal, with or without an additional more proximal infra-inguinal, revascularisation procedure to restore limb perfusion. METHODS: Bypass versus Angioplasty for Severe Ischaemia of the Leg (BASIL)-2 was an open-label, pragmatic, multicentre, phase 3, randomised trial done at 41 vascular surgery units in the UK (n=39), Sweden (n=1), and Denmark (n=1). Eligible patients were those who presented to hospital-based vascular surgery units with chronic limb-threatening ischaemia due to atherosclerotic disease and who required an infra-popliteal, with or without an additional more proximal infra-inguinal, revascularisation procedure to restore limb perfusion. Participants were randomly assigned (1:1) to receive either vein bypass (vein bypass group) or best endovascular treatment (best endovascular treatment group) as their first revascularisation procedure through a secure online randomisation system. Participants were excluded if they had ischaemic pain or tissue loss considered not to be primarily due to atherosclerotic peripheral artery disease. Most vein bypasses used the great saphenous vein and originated from the common or superficial femoral arteries. Most endovascular interventions comprised plain balloon angioplasty with selective use of plain or drug eluting stents. Participants were followed up for a minimum of 2 years. Data were collected locally at participating centres. In England, Wales, and Sweden, centralised databases were used to collect information on amputations and deaths. Data were analysed centrally at the Birmingham Clinical Trials Unit. The primary outcome was amputation-free survival defined as time to first major (above the ankle) amputation or death from any cause measured in the intention-to-treat population. Safety was assessed by monitoring serious adverse events up to 30-days after first revascularisation. The trial is registered with the ISRCTN registry, ISRCTN27728689. FINDINGS: Between July 22, 2014, and Nov 30, 2020, 345 participants (65 [19%] women and 280 [81%] men; median age 72·5 years [62·7-79·3]) with chronic limb-threatening ischaemia were enrolled in the trial and randomly assigned: 172 (50%) to the vein bypass group and 173 (50%) to the best endovascular treatment group. Major amputation or death occurred in 108 (63%) of 172 patients in the vein bypass group and 92 (53%) of 173 patients in the best endovascular treatment group (adjusted hazard ratio [HR] 1·35 [95% CI 1·02-1·80]; p=0·037). 91 (53%) of 172 patients in the vein bypass group and 77 (45%) of 173 patients in the best endovascular treatment group died (adjusted HR 1·37 [95% CI 1·00-1·87]). In both groups the most common causes of morbidity and death, including that occurring within 30 days of their first revascularisation, were cardiovascular (61 deaths in the vein bypass group and 49 in the best endovascular treatment group) and respiratory events (25 deaths in the vein bypass group and 23 in the best endovascular treatment group; number of cardiovascular and respiratory deaths were not mutually exclusive). INTERPRETATION: In the BASIL-2 trial, a best endovascular treatment first revascularisation strategy was associated with a better amputation-free survival, which was largely driven by fewer deaths in the best endovascular treatment group. These data suggest that more patients with chronic limb-threatening ischaemia who required an infra-popliteal, with or without an additional more proximal infra-inguinal, revascularisation procedure to restore limb perfusion should be considered for a best endovascular treatment first revascularisation strategy. RESUMO

BACKGROUND: There is a clinical need for treatments that can slow or prevent the growth of an abdominal aortic aneurysm, not only to reduce the need for surgery, but to provide a means to treat those who cannot undergo surgery. METHODS: Analysis of the UK Aneurysm Growth Study (UKAGS) prospective cohort was conducted to test for an association between cardiometabolic medications and the growth of an abdominal aortic aneurysm above 30 mm in diameter, using linear mixed-effect models. RESULTS: A total of 3670 male participants with data available on abdominal aortic aneurysm growth, smoking status, co-morbidities, and medication history were included. The mean age at recruitment was 69.5 years, the median number of surveillance scans was 6, and the mean(s.e.) unadjusted abdominal aortic aneurysm growth rate was 1.75(0.03) mm/year. In a multivariate linear mixed-effect model, smoking (mean(s.e.) +0.305(0.07) mm/year, P = 0.00003) and antiplatelet use (mean(s.e.) +0.235(0.06) mm/year, P = 0.00018) were found to be associated with more rapid abdominal aortic aneurysm growth, whilst metformin was strongly associated with slower abdominal aortic aneurysm growth (mean(s.e.) -0.38(0.1) mm/year, P = 0.00019), as were angiotensin-converting enzyme inhibitors (mean(s.e.) -0.243(0.07) mm/year, P = 0.0004), angiotensin II receptor antagonists (mean(s.e.) -0.253(0.08) mm/year, P = 0.00255), and thiazides/related diuretics (mean(s.e.) -0.307(0.09) mm/year, P = 0.00078). CONCLUSION: The strong association of metformin with slower abdominal aortic aneurysm growth highlights the importance of the ongoing clinical trials assessing the effectiveness of metformin with regard to the prevention of abdominal aortic aneurysm growth and/or rupture. The association of angiotensin-converting enzyme inhibitors, angiotensin II receptor antagonists, and diuretics with slower abdominal aortic aneurysm growth points to the possibility that optimization of cardiovascular risk management as part of abdominal aortic aneurysm surveillance may have the secondary benefit of also reducing abdominal aortic aneurysm growth rates.

RESUMO

OBJECTIVE: Biomimetic stents are peripheral infrainguinal self expanding stents that mimic the anatomy of the vasculature and artery movement. They are indicated for use in infrainguinal arteries. This research aimed to synthesise all current evidence on the use of biomimetic stents as adjuncts for endovascular treatment of infrainguinal peripheral arterial disease (PAD), helping to guide clinical decision making. DATA SOURCES: MEDLINE, Embase, CINAHL and Cochrane databases. REVIEW METHODS: Random effects meta-analysis following PRISMA guidelines (PROSPERO registration CRD42022385256). Study quality was assessed using the Joanna Briggs Institute critical appraisal tools checklist, and certainty assessment through the Grading of Recommendations, Assessment, Development and Evaluation (GRADE). Endpoints included primary patency, target lesion revascularisation, stent fracture, secondary patency, and Death at one year. RESULTS: In total, 37 studies were included in the meta-analysis (33 cohort studies, two case series, and two randomised controlled trials [RCTs]), representing 4 480 participants. Of these, 34 studies included data on the Supera (81.5% of participants) and three studies reported data on the BioMimics 3D (18.5% of participants) stents. The pooled primary patency rate of 33 studies at one year follow up was 81.4% (95% confidence interval [CI] 78.7 - 83.9%), and the pooled target lesion revascularisation rate of 18 studies at one year was 12.2% (95% CI 9.6 - 15.0%). The certainty of evidence outcome rating as qualified by GRADE was very low for both. Only one study reported a positive stent fracture rate at one year follow up of 0.4% with a certainty of evidence outcome of low. CONCLUSION: Using biomimetic stents for infrainguinal PAD may be associated with acceptable one year primary patency and target lesion revascularisation rates, with a near negligible one year stent fracture rate. Their use should be considered in those presenting with infrainguinal PAD undergoing endovascular revascularisation. A RCT is necessary to determine their clinical and cost effectiveness.

RESUMO

OBJECTIVE: To report the cost of target lesion revascularisation procedures (TLR) for femoropopliteal peripheral artery disease (PAD) following stenting, from a healthcare payer's perspective. METHODS: European multicentre study involving consecutive patients requiring femoropopliteal TLR (January 2017 - December 2021). The primary outcome was overall cost (euros) associated with a TLR procedure from presentation to discharge. Exact costs per constituent, clinical characteristics, and early outcomes were reported. RESULTS: This study included 482 TLR procedures (retrospectively, 13 hospitals, six countries): 56% were female, mean age was 75 ± 2 years, 61% were Rutherford class 5 or 6, 67% had Tosaka class 3 disease, and 16% had common femoral or iliac involvement. A total of 52% were hybrid procedures and 6% involved open surgery only. Technical success was 70%, 30 day mortality rate was 1%, and the 30 day major amputation rate was 4%. Most costs were for operating time during the TLR (healthcare professionals' salaries, indirect and estate costs), with a mean of: €21 917 ± €2 110 for all procedures; €23 337 ± €8 920 for open procedures; €12 903 ± €3 108 for endovascular procedures; and €22 806 ± €3 977 for hybrid procedures. In a regression analysis, procedure duration was the main parameter associated with higher overall TLR costs (coefficient, 2.77; standard error, 0.88; p < .001). The mean cost per operating minute of TLR (indirect, estate costs, all salaried staff present included) was €177 and the mean cost per night stay in hospital (outside intensive care unit) was €356. The mean cost per overnight intensive care unit stay (minimum of 8 hours per night) was €1 193. CONCLUSION: The main driver of the considerable peri-procedure costs associated with femoropopliteal TLR was procedure time.

RESUMO

Background: This study aimed to assess the peri- and postprocedural outcomes of atherectomy-assisted endovascular treatment of the common femoral (CFA) and popliteal arteries. Methods: Phoenix atherectomy was used for the treatment of 73 and 53 de novo CFA and popliteal artery lesions, respectively, in 122 consecutive patients. Safety endpoints encompassed perforation and peripheral embolization. Postprocedural endpoints included freedom from clinically driven target lesion revascularization (CD-TLR) and clinical success (an improvement of ⩾ 2 Rutherford category [RC]). In addition, 531 patients treated for popliteal artery stenosis or occlusion without atherectomy were used as a comparator group. Results: Procedural success (residual stenosis < 30% after treatment) was 99.2%. The need for bail-out stenting was 2 (2.7%) and 3 (5.7%) in CFA and popliteal artery lesions, respectively. Only one (1.4%) embolization occurred in the CFA, which was treated by catheter aspiration. No perforations occurred. After 1.50 (IQR = 1.17-2.20) years, CD-TLR occurred in seven (9.2%) and six (14.6%) patients with CFA and popliteal artery lesions, respectively, whereas clinical success was achieved in 62 (91.2%) and 31 (75.6%), respectively. Patients treated with atherectomy and DCB in the popliteal artery after matching for baseline RC, lesion calcification, length, and the presence of chronic total occlusion, exhibited higher freedom from CD-TLR compared to the nondebulking group (HR = 3.1; 95% CI = 1.1-8.5, p = 0.03). Conclusion: Atherectomy can be used safely and is associated with low rates of bail-out stenting in CFA and popliteal arteries. CD-TLR and clinical success rates are clinically acceptable. In addition, for the popliteal artery, atherectomy combined with DCB demonstrates lower CD-TLR rates compared to a DCB alone strategy. (German Clinical Trials Register: DRKS00016708).

RESUMO

Peripheral artery disease (PAD) is the lower limb manifestation of systemic atherosclerotic disease. PAD may initially present with symptoms of intermittent claudication, whilst chronic limb-threatening ischaemia (CLTI), the end stage of PAD, presents with rest pain and/or tissue loss. PAD is an age-related condition present in over 10% of those aged ≥65 in high-income countries. Guidelines regarding definition, diagnosis and staging of PAD and CLTI have been updated to reflect the changing patterns and presentations of disease given the increasing prevalence of diabetes. Recent research has changed guidelines on optimal medical therapy, with low-dose anticoagulant plus aspirin recommended in some patients. Recently published randomised trials highlight where bypass-first or endovascular-first approaches may be optimal in infra-inguinal disease. New techniques in endovascular surgery have increased minimally invasive options for ever more complex disease. Increasing recognition has been given to the complexity of patients with CLTI where a high prevalence of both frailty and cognitive impairment are present and a significant burden of multi-morbidity and polypharmacy. Despite advances in minimally invasive revascularisation techniques and reduction in amputation incidence, survival remains poor for many with CLTI. Shared decision-making is essential, and conservative management is often appropriate for older patients. There is emerging evidence of the benefit of specialist geriatric team input in the perioperative management of older patients undergoing surgery for CLTI. Recent UK guidelines now recommend screening for frailty, cognitive impairment and delirium in older vascular surgery patients as well as recommending all vascular surgery services have support and input from specialist geriatrics teams.

RESUMO

BACKGROUND: The mid-term results after treatment of isolated popliteal lesions have been limited. The aim of the present study was to report the mid-term outcomes after endovascular treatment of isolated atherosclerotic popliteal artery lesions. METHODS: A multicenter (15 hospitals in five countries) retrospective cohort study was performed. Between June 2016 and June 2021, 651 consecutive patients who had been treated for isolated popliteal lesions using endovascular methods exclusively were included in the present study. Six techniques were identified, including plain balloon angioplasty (PTA; n = 286; 43.9%), drug-coated balloon angioplasty (n = 98; 15.1%), stenting with low-chronic outward force (COF) stents (n = 84; 12.9%), stenting with high-COF stents (n = 76; 11.7%), atherectomy alone (n = 17; 2.6%), and directional atherectomy with drug-coated balloons (n = 90; 13.8%). The primary outcomes measures were primary and secondary patency and freedom from clinically driven target lesion revascularization (F-CDTLR). RESULTS: The mean patient age was 74.5 years. Most of the patients (n = 409; 62.9%) had had chronic limb-threatening ischemia. Popliteal occlusion was found in 400 cases (61.4%). High-grade calcification was present in 36.7% of cases. Immediate technical success was 94.8%. The median follow-up was 26 months (range, 6-42 months). The actuarial rate for all patients at 26 months (per outcome measure) was as follows: primary patency, 73.9%; secondary patency, 88%; and F-CDTLR, 76.5%. When comparing PTA vs all other treatments in an adjusted regression analysis, the F-CDTLR was 75.2% for PTA vs 76.5% for all other treatment (hazard ratio, 1.06; 95% confidence interval, 0.75-1.48; P = .46, adjusted regression). The difference in secondary patency also was not statistically significant (85.7% for PTA vs 88%; P = .20). Adjusted Kaplan-Meier analysis revealed that the estimated primary patency was inferior for PTA in pairwise comparisons vs other treatments (P < .001 vs atherectomy; P = .002 vs directional atherectomy with drug-coated balloons; and P = .002 vs low-COF stenting). CONCLUSIONS: The results from our study have shown that endovascular treatment of isolated popliteal lesions is safe and associated with acceptable patency and F-CDTLR in the mid-term.

RESUMO

Atherosclerotic renovascular disease (ARVD) is the most common type of renal artery stenosis. It represents a common health problem with clinical presentations relevant to many medical specialties and carries a high risk for future cardiovascular and renal events, as well as overall mortality. The available evidence regarding the management of ARVD is conflicting. Randomized controlled trials failed to demonstrate superiority of percutaneous transluminal renal artery angioplasty (PTRA) with or without stenting in addition to standard medical therapy compared with medical therapy alone in lowering blood pressure levels or preventing adverse renal and cardiovascular outcomes in patients with ARVD, but they carried several limitations and met important criticism. Observational studies showed that PTRA is associated with future cardiorenal benefits in patients presenting with high-risk ARVD phenotypes (i.e. flash pulmonary oedema, resistant hypertension or rapid loss of kidney function). This clinical practice document, prepared by experts from the European Renal Best Practice (ERBP) board of the European Renal Association (ERA) and from the Working Group on Hypertension and the Kidney of the European Society of Hypertension (ESH), summarizes current knowledge in epidemiology, pathophysiology and diagnostic assessment of ARVD and presents, following a systematic literature review, key evidence relevant to treatment, with an aim to support clinicians in decision making and everyday management of patients with this condition.

RESUMO

BACKGROUND: Patients with chronic limb-threatening ischemia (CLTI) and chronic kidney disease (CKD) are at risk of developing renal injury following revascularization. We aimed to compare the risk of adverse renal events following endovascular revascularization (ER) or open surgery (OS) in patients with CLTI and CKD. METHODS: A retrospective analysis of the National Surgical Quality Improvement Program (NSQIP) databases (2011-2017) was performed including patients with CLTI and non-dialysis-dependent CKD, comparing ER to OS. The primary outcome was a composite of postprocedural kidney injury or failure within 30 days. Thirty-day mortality, major adverse cardiac and cerebrovascular events (MACCE), amputation, readmission or target lesion revascularization (TLR) were compared using multivariate logistic regression and propensity-score matched analysis. RESULTS: A total of 5009 patients were included (ER: 2361; OS: 3409). The risk for the composite primary outcome was comparable between groups (odds ratio [OR]: 0.78, 95% confidence interval (CI): 0.53-1.17) as for kidney injury (n=54, OR: 0.97, 95% CI: 0.39-1.19) or failure (n=55, OR: 0.68, 95% CI: 0.39-1.19). In the adjusted regression, a significant benefit was observed with ER for the primary outcome (OR: 0.60, p=0.018) and renal failure (OR: 0.50, p=0.025), but not for renal injury (OR: 0.76, p=0.34). Lower rates of MACCE, TLR, and readmissions were observed after ER. Thirty-day mortality and major amputation rates did not differ. In the propensity score analysis, revascularization strategy was not associated with renal injury or failure. CONCLUSIONS: In this cohort, the incidence of renal events within 30 days of revascularization in CLTI was low and comparable between ER and OR. CLINICAL IMPACT: In a cohort of 5009 patients with chronic limb-threatening ischemia and non-end-stage chronic kidney disease (CKD), postprocedural kidney injury or failure within 30 days was comparable between patients submitted to open or endovascular revascularization (ER). Lower rates of major adverse cardiac and cerebrovascular events, target lesion revascularization, and readmissions were observed after endovascular revascularization. Based on these findings, ER should not be avoided due to fear of worsening renal function in CKD patients with chronic limb-threatening ischemia. In fact, these patients benefit more from ER regarding cardiovascular outcomes with no increased risk of kidney injury.

RESUMO

OBJECTIVE: Acute kidney injury (AKI) is common in patients with aortic diseases; however, it has not been extensively studied in acute type B aortic dissection (TBAD). AKI is known to be associated with adverse kidney outcomes and premature death. This study investigated the incidence and impact of AKI in patients with acute TBAD. METHODS: This was a retrospective study including data from two tertiary vascular centres in the UK. Case notes and electronic records were reviewed for consecutive patients presenting with acute symptomatic TBAD. Patients were managed according to a uniform clinical protocol; both patients who underwent surgery and those managed conservatively were included in this analysis. Serum creatinine values were used to calculate the number of patients who developed AKI, based on validated Kidney Disease Improving Global Outcomes definitions. Associations between incidence of AKI, death, and Major Adverse Kidney Events (MAKE; defined as death, dialysis and/or drop in estimated glomerular filtration rate > 25%) were explored. RESULTS: Overall, 66 (42.6%) of 155 patients developed AKI within one week of presenting with TBAD. Of these, 23 patients (34.8%) had stage 1, 26 patients (39.4%) stage 2, and 17 patients (25.8%) stage 3 AKI. MAKE at 30 and 90 days occurred in 17 (11.0%) and 12 patients (7.7%), respectively. AKI was associated with significantly worse outcomes, with a 24.2% mortality rate in the AKI group compared with 7.8% among those with no AKI (p <.001); this association was also significant in adjusted analyses, both in patients who did and did not undergo surgery. CONCLUSION: AKI is very common among patients presenting with acute TBAD, even in clinically uncomplicated disease. There was a significant association with mortality and MAKE, whether patients underwent surgery or not. This warrants further investigation to better understand the underlying causes of the AKI and investigate management strategies which may improve outcomes.

RESUMO

OBJECTIVE: Bullying, undermining behaviour, and harassment (BUH) may exist in healthcare settings, impacting on patient care. The aim of this international study was to evaluate the characteristics of BUH experienced by physicians treating vascular diseases at various career stages. METHODS: This was an anonymous international structured non-validated cross-sectional survey distributed via relevant professional societies in collaboration with the Research Collaborative in Peripheral Artery Disease. The survey was disseminated through societies' newsletters, emails, and social media. Data were collected online, allowing free text entries alongside structured multiple choice questions based on previous surveys. Demographics, geographical information, and data relating to stage and training environment were collected. RESULTS: Of 587 respondents from 28 countries, 86% were working in vascular surgery, mostly at a university hospital (56%); 81% were aged between 31 and 60 years, 57% were working as a consultant, and 23% as a resident. Respondents were mostly white (83%), male (63%), heterosexual (94%), and without disability (96%). Overall, 253 (43%) reported experiencing BUH personally, 75% had witnessed BUH toward colleagues, and 51% witnessed these in the last 12 months. Female sex and non-white ethnicity were associated with BUH (53% vs. 38% and 57% vs. 40% respectively; p < .001 in both cases). While working as a consultant, 171 (50%) reported experiencing BUH, more often among females, non-heterosexuals, those who were not working in their country of birth, and non-white people. Specialty and hospital type were not associated with BUH. CONCLUSION: BUH remains a major problem in the vascular workplace. Female sex, non-heterosexuality, and non-white ethnicity are associated with BUH at various career stages.

RESUMO

OBJECTIVE: Bypass surgery plays a key role in complex lower limb lesions. However, there is a lack of evidence regarding the management of symptomatic prosthetic bypass graft (PBG) occlusion. This study aimed to report outcomes following open, hybrid, or endovascular management of patients presenting with symptomatic PBG occlusion. METHODS: A multicentre, retrospective cohort study was conducted, including patients presenting with PBG occlusion between January 2014 and December 2021 from 18 centres. It assessed the comparative value of treatment strategies, including (1) recanalisation of native vessels, (2) endovascular treatment of the failed PBG, (3) hybrid treatment, and (4) open surgery. The primary outcome measure was amputation free survival (AFS, time to major amputation and or death), whereas all cause mortality, major amputation, PBG re-occlusion, target lesion revascularisation (TLR), and Rutherford category (RC) improvement during follow up were considered as secondary endpoints. RESULTS: Of 260 patients with occluded PBGs, 108 (41.5%) were treated endovascularly (24 [22.2%] by recanalisation of native vessels and 84 [77.7%] by PBG re-opening), 57 (21.9%) underwent hybrid revascularisation, and 58 (22.3%) had surgery. In addition, 27 (10.4%) were treated conservatively and 10 (3.8%) received systemic thrombolysis. With a median follow up of 1.4 (0.6 - 3.0) years, AFS was 95.5%, 76.4%, 45.5%, and 37.1%, respectively in Groups 1 - 4 (p = .007). Older age and non-endovascular treatment (HR 1.05 and 1.70; p < .01 for both) were independent predictors of poor AFS. Endovascular treatment was associated with lower rates of major amputation (p = .04), PBG re-occlusion (p < .001), and TLR (p = .037), and higher RC improvements (p < .001), whereas all cause mortality was comparable between treatment groups (p = .21). CONCLUSION: Endovascular treatment is associated with higher rates of AFS and RC improvement and lower rates of PBG re-occlusion and TLR in patients with PBG occlusion.

RESUMO

OBJECTIVE: The aim was to assess the proportion of patients undergoing endovascular therapy for femoropopliteal arterial disease (FP) who would be eligible to take part in seven major randomised controlled trials (RCTs) that investigated the efficacy of some of the currently available paclitaxel based (PTX) devices used in this clinical context. Various RCTs have shown a potential clinical benefit from the use of paclitaxel in FP endovascular therapy. Nonetheless, patients enrolled were highly selected and the generalisability of these findings in pragmatic cohorts is unclear. METHODS: Between 1 January and 31 December 2021, all consecutive patients who underwent endovascular procedures for symptomatic FP disease in 16 European centres were retrospectively screened and included in this analysis. The primary outcome measure was individual patient eligibility for inclusion into at least one of the seven RCTs. The reasons for exclusion (clinical and or radiological) as well as in hospital death and morbidity were also reported. RESULTS: A total of 1 567 consecutive patients (959 male, 61%), corresponding to 1 567 lower limbs, were included. Most patients (1 009 patients, 64.39%) were treated for chronic limb threatening ischaemia (CLTI). A total 1 280 patients (81.68%) were not eligible for inclusion in any of the evaluated RCTs. Of them, 741 (47.28%) were excluded for clinical and 1 125 (71.79%) for radiological reasons. CONCLUSION: The analysed RCTs assessing the efficacy or effectiveness of PTX based endovascular therapies do not seem representative of the patient population with FP disease receiving endovascular therapy in routine clinical practice.

RESUMO

BACKGROUND: The widespread introduction of minimally invasive endovascular techniques in cardiovascular surgery has necessitated a transition in the psychomotor skillset of trainees and surgeons. Simulation has previously been used in surgical training; however, there is limited high-quality evidence regarding the role of simulation-based training on the acquisition of endovascular skills. This systematic review aimed to systematically appraise the currently available evidence regarding endovascular high-fidelity simulation interventions, to describe the overarching strategies used, the learning outcomes addressed, the choice of assessment methodology, and the impact of education on learner performance. METHODS: A comprehensive literature review was performed in accordance with the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) statement using relevant keywords to identify studies evaluating simulation in the acquisition of endovascular surgical skills. References of review articles were screened for additional studies. RESULTS: A total of 1,081 studies were identified (474 after removal of duplicates). There was marked heterogeneity in methodologies and reporting of outcomes. Quantitative analysis was deemed inappropriate due to the risk of serious confounding and bias. Instead, a descriptive synthesis was performed, summarizing key findings and quality components. Eighteen studies were included in the synthesis (15 observational, 2 case-control and 1 randomized control studies). Most studies measured procedure time, contrast usage, and fluoroscopy time. Other metrics were recorded to a lesser extent. Significant reductions were noted in both procedure and fluoroscopy times with the introduction of simulation-based endovascular training. CONCLUSIONS: The evidence regarding the use of high-fidelity simulation in endovascular training is very heterogeneous. The current literature suggests simulation-based training leads to improvements in performance, mostly in terms of procedure and fluoroscopy time. High-quality randomized control trials are needed to establish the clinical benefits of simulation training, sustainability of improvements, transferability of skills and its cost-effectiveness.

RESUMO

PURPOSE: To examine the association between acute kidney injury (AKI) severity and duration with cardiovascular mortality, following endovascular treatment of femoropopliteal disease, and whether it is AKI in itself that confers an increased risk of cardiovascular mortality. METHODS: A retrospective analysis of prospectively collected data obtained between 2014 and 2019 from 3 vascular centers. Renal function was followed up for a minimum of 90 days. Electronic records were queried to establish a cause of death, where applicable. Patients were excluded if unable to provide written informed consent or if presenting with acute limb ischemia. Primary outcomes were the hazard ratios for cardiovascular death (AKI patients vs no AKI; no AKI vs stage 1 AKI vs stage 3 AKI; and no AKI vs transient AKI vs established AKI). Propensity score-matched analysis was used to establish whether developing AKI, in patients with similar demographics and procedural characteristics, is associated with a higher risk of cardiovascular death. RESULTS: Overall 239 patients developed AKI, and this was associated with an increased risk of cardiovascular mortality (hazard risk [HR]: 4.3, 95% confidence intervals [CIs]: 2.1-6.8, pairwise comparison p value=0.006]. This was dependent on the severity of the AKI stage (HR 5.4, 95% CI: 2.4-7.3, pairwise comparison p value=0.01) and duration (HR 4.2, 95% CI: 2.3-6.2, pairwise comparison p value=0.04). The propensity score-matched analysis showed that even when patients are matched for comorbidity and procedural characteristics, AKI confers an increased risk of mortality (p=0.04). CONCLUSIONS: Acute kidney injury is common after femoropopliteal endovascular therapy. It confers an increased risk of long-term cardiovascular mortality, which is still present when renal decline is transient, and highest for patients with established decline in renal function. CLINICAL IMPACT: This is the first study in the setting of peripheral arterial disease to show that acute kidney injury has an adverse effect on cardiovascular mortality, in the long-term, that is dependent on its severity, and present even when the AKI is transient. We have also shown that this difference in cardiovascular mortality becomes more pronounced from the medium-term, and thus closer follow-up of these patients is required.

RESUMO

BACKGROUND: Endovascular stenting of the deep venous system has been proposed as a method to treat patients with symptomatic iliofemoral outflow obstruction. The purpose of this systematic review and meta-analysis was to compare the effectiveness of this treatment at 1-year following the development of dedicated venous stents. METHOD AND RESULTS: We searched MEDLINE and EMBASE for studies evaluating the effectiveness of venous stent placement. Data were extracted by disease pathogenesis: non-thrombotic iliac vein lesions (NIVL), acute thrombotic (DVT), or post-thrombotic syndrome (PTS). Main outcomes included technical success, stent patency at 1 year and symptom relief. A total of 49 studies reporting outcomes in 5154 patients (NIVL, 1431; DVT, 950; PTS, 2773) were included in the meta-analysis. Technical success rates were comparable among groups (97%-100%). There were no periprocedural deaths. Minor bleeding was reported in up to 5% of patients and major bleeding in 0.5% upon intervention. Transient back pain was noted in 55% of PTS patients following intervention. There was significant heterogeneity between studies reporting outcomes in PTS patients. Primary and cumulative patency at 1 year was: NIVL-96% and 100%; DVT-91% and 97%; PTS (stents above the ligament)-77% and 94%, and; PTS (stents across the ligament)-78% and 94%. There were insufficient data to compare patency outcomes of dedicated and nondedicated venous stents in patients with acute DVT. In NIVL and PTS patients, stent patency was comparable at 1 year. There was inconsistency in the use of validated tools for the measurement of symptoms before and after intervention. When reported, venous claudication, improved in 83% of PTS patients and 90% of NIVL patients, and ulcer healing occurred in 80% of PTS patients and 32% of NIVL patients. CONCLUSIONS: The first generation of dedicated venous stents perform comparably in terms of patency and clinical outcomes to non-dedicated technologies at 1 year for the treatment of patients with NIVL and PTS. However, significant heterogeneity exists between studies and standardized criteria are urgently needed to report outcomes in patients undergoing deep venous stenting.

RESUMO

OBJECTIVE: To report outcomes following endovascular revascularisation for severe aorto-iliac occlusive disease (AIOD) using covered (CS) or bare metal (BMS) stent(s). METHODS: This was a retrospective cohort study including patients who underwent treatment with CS or BMS for AIOD between November 2012 and March 2020 in 12 European centres. Outcome measures included death, freedom from target lesion revascularisation (TLR), major amputation, and major adverse cardiac and cerebrovascular events (MACCE). RESULTS: Overall, 252 patients (53% males; mean age 65 ± 10 years) were included (102 with a bare metal and 150 with a covered aortic stent); 122 (48%) presented with chronic limb threatening ischaemia (CLTI). Severe arterial calcification was noted in > 65% of patients, 70% presented with Trans-Atlantic Societies Consensus (TASC) D lesions, 32% and 46% had aortic or iliac chronic total occlusion (CTO), respectively. Median follow up was 17 months (range 6 - 40; none lost to follow up). Median inpatient stay was two days (range two to four). During the first 30 days, two patients died (both with covered aortic stents, because of cardiovascular events), none required TLR, two (1%) patients had a major amputation (all presented with CLTI), and three (1%) had a MACCE. At 17 months, mortality (BMS 14% vs. CS 7%, hazard ratio [HR] 0.97, 95% confidence interval [CI] 0.42 - 2.26, p = .94, log rank test) and TLR (11% vs. 10%, HR 1.98, 95% CI 0.89 - 4.43, p = .095) did not differ statistically significantly between the two groups; only three patients had a major limb amputation during late follow up (all with a covered stent). In a multivariable model, the use of an aortic CS did not influence TLR. In a conditional Cox regression, however, the concomitant use of aortic and iliac CSs was associated with improved freedom from TLR. CONCLUSION: Endovascular reconstruction with aortic CSs or BMSs for severe AIOD showed comparable midterm performance. The use of both aortic and iliac CSs seems to be associated with reduced TLR.

RESUMO

OBJECTIVES: The role of antithrombotic therapy in the management of aortic and peripheral aneurysms is unclear. This systematic review and meta-analysis aimed to assess the impact of antithrombotics on clinical outcomes for aortic and peripheral aneurysms. METHODS: Medline, Embase, and CENTRAL databases were searched. Randomised controlled trials and observational studies investigating the effect of antithrombotic therapy on clinical outcomes for patients with any aortic or peripheral artery aneurysm were included. RESULTS: Fifty-nine studies (28 with antiplatelet agents, 12 anticoagulants, two intra-operative heparin, and 16 any antithrombotic agent) involving 122 102 patients were included. Abdominal aortic aneurysm (AAA) growth rate was not significantly associated with the use of antiplatelet therapy (SMD -0.36 mm/year; 95% CI -0.75 - 0.02; p = .060; GRADE certainty: very low). Antithrombotics were associated with increased 30 day mortality for patients with AAAs undergoing intervention (OR 2.30; 95% CI 1.51 - 3.51; p < .001; GRADE certainty: low). Following intervention, antiplatelet therapy was associated with reduced long term all cause mortality (HR 0.84; 95% CI 0.76 - 0.92; p < .001; GRADE certainty: moderate), whilst anticoagulants were associated with increased all cause mortality (HR 1.64; 95% CI 1.14 - 2.37; p = .008; GRADE certainty: very low), endoleak within three years (OR 1.99; 95% CI 1.10 - 3.60; p = .020; I2 = 60%; GRADE certainty: very low), and an increased re-intervention rate at one year (OR 3.25; 95% CI 1.82 - 5.82; p < .001; I2 = 35%; GRADE certainty: moderate). Five studies examined antithrombotic therapy for popliteal aneurysms. Meta-analysis was not possible due to heterogeneity. CONCLUSIONS: There was a lack of high quality data examining antithrombotic therapy for patients with aneurysms. Antiplatelet therapy was associated with a reduction in post-intervention all cause mortality for AAA, whilst anticoagulants were associated with an increased risk of all cause mortality, endoleak, and re-intervention. Large, well designed trials are still required to determine the therapeutic benefits of antithrombotic agents in this setting.

RESUMO

OBJECTIVE: The aims of the present study were to assess the relative proportion of collagen and elastin in the arterial wall and to evaluate the collagen microstructure from the aortic root to the external iliac artery. METHODS: Arterial wall tissue samples sampled during post-mortem examination from 16 sites in 14 individuals without aneurysm disease were fixed and stained for collagen and elastin. Stained sections were imaged and analysed to calculate collagen and elastin content as a percentage of overall tissue area. Scanning electron microscopy was used to quantify the collagen microstructure at six specific arterial regions. RESULTS: From the aortic root to the level of the suprarenal aorta, the percentages (area fractions) of collagen (ascending, descending, and suprarenal aorta respectively with 95% confidence interval [CI] 37.5%, 31.7 - 43.2; 38.9%, 33.1 - 44.7; 44.8%, 37.4 - 52.1) and elastin (43.0%, 37.3 - 48.8; 40.3%, 34.8 - 46.1; 32.4%, 25.2 - 39.6) in the aortic wall were similar. From the suprarenal aorta to the internal iliac arteries, the percentage of collagen increased (abdominal aorta, common and internal iliac arteries and external iliac artery respectively with 95% CI 50.6%, 42.7 - 58.7; 51.2%, 45.5 - 56.9; 49.2%, 42.0 - 56.4) reaching a double percentage for elastin (23.6%, 15.7 - 31.6; 20.8%, 15.1 - 26.5; 22.2%, 14.9 - 29.5). Mean collagen fibre diameter (MFD) and average segment length (ASL) were significantly larger in the external iliac artery (MFD 6.03, 95% CI 5.95 - 6.11; ASL 22.21, 95% CI 20.80 - 23.61) than in the ascending aorta (MFD 5.81, 5.72 - 5.89; ASL 19.47, 18.07 - 20.88) and the abdominal aorta (MFD 5.92, 5.84 - 6.00; ASL 21.10, 19.69 - 22.50). CONCLUSION: In subjects lacking aneurysmal disease, the aorta and iliac arteries are not structurally uniform along their length. There is an increase in collagen percentage and decrease in elastin percentage progressing distally along the aorta. Mean collagen fibre diameter and average segment length are larger in the external iliac artery, compared with the ascending and the abdominal aorta.

RESUMO

OBJECTIVE: Advances in endovascular technologies have allowed the treatment of common femoral artery (CFA) steno-occlusive disease by minimally invasive means; however, the proportion of lesions treated with common femoral artery endarterectomy (CFAE) which would be amenable to endovascular treatment is unknown. This observational study aimed to describe the morphology and composition of CFA lesions treated with CFAE and report the proportion that would be amenable to endovascular treatment with modern technologies. METHODS: Patients presenting with symptomatic peripheral artery disease who underwent CFAE from January 2014 to December 2018 in two tertiary NHS hospitals were included. Extensive data relating to patient demographics, risk factors, clinical outcomes, as well as anatomical and morphological characteristics of the CFA atherosclerotic lesions, were collected which included detailed plaque analysis using 3D reconstruction of pre-operative computed tomography angiograms. CFA lesions were considered suitable for endovascular treatment if presented with patent iliac inflow, at least one patent outflow vessel (superficial femoral artery [SFA] or profunda femoral artery [PFA]), and stenotic rather than occluded CFA. RESULTS: A total of 829 CFAs in 737 consecutive patients who underwent CFAE were included (mean age 71 ± 10 years; 526 males, 71%); 451 (62%) presented with chronic limb threatening ischaemia. Overall, 35% of CFAs had a localised lesion (no bifurcation disease) that could possibly be treated endovascularly. In total, 376 (45%) target vessels did not feature severe calcium load, with a patent CFA, PFA, and proximal SFA and therefore would have been amenable to endovascular treatment; while 271 CFAs (33%) featured a significant calcium load which would have potentially required stenting. CONCLUSION: A significant proportion of patients with atherosclerotic CFA lesions who undergo surgery could potentially be candidates for endovascular treatment. A randomised trial comparing CFAE and new endovascular techniques in this clinical context is required.
